La Biblioteca de Compuestos de la Medicina Tradicional China (MTC) es una colección integral de compuestos bioactivos derivados de plantas medicinales chinas tradicionales. Esta biblioteca incluye una amplia gama de compuestos con diversas actividades farmacológicas, como propiedades antiinflamatorias, antioxidantes, anticancerígenas y antimicrobianas. Los investigadores utilizan esta biblioteca para explorar el potencial terapéutico de los compuestos de la MTC en el descubrimiento y desarrollo de fármacos.
